2012-08-31-Critical Mass Houston : img_1940

2012-08-31 Friday 9:24pm CDT
at 29.8192624,-95.4203040 (osm) (gmap) (nearby pictures)
near 3393 Alba Road, Houston, TX 77018

Back


img_1937

img_1941


img_1937

img_1941


Share this on Facebook


Powered by album tool from MarginalHacks by David Sat Sep 1 14:51:20 2012